Fake leaflets featuring Klaus Iohannis supporting Nicușor Dan spark accusations of electoral manipulation

In Bucharest, leaflets featuring Klaus Iohannis supporting Nicușor Dan in the presidential elections have been distributed, but Dan's team disputes their authenticity, considering them a manipulation. Dan's supporters, including MEP Vlad Gheorghe, say it is a campaign coordinated by a major party. The message attributed to Iohannis, stressing the importance of continuing the 'Educated Romania' project, could negatively affect Dan's image, given the former president's low trust rating. The authorities could investigate the source of the leaflets and responsibility for this electoral misinformation.
